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Hoveton & Wroxham to Castle Bar Park start from as little as £14.00

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Hoveton & Wroxham to Castle Bar Park start from £75.10 one way, or £76.10 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Hoveton & Wroxham to Castle Bar Park are available for £111.30 one way, or £161.10 return

Facilities and Amenities

At Hoveton & Wroxham, you won't find a traditional ticket office, but fear not. The station is equipped with ticket machines, allowing you to collect tickets purchased online conveniently. These machines are user-friendly and accessible, ensuring that everyone can obtain their tickets with ease. There is an induction loop available for those with hearing impairments, and customer help points provide assistance when staff is on site.

Accessibility at the station has been thoughtfully considered. Step-free access is available to both platforms through separate pathways, although note there is no step-free access between platforms directly. The station is bicycle-friendly, with ample storage space, though there are no cycle hire facilities available.

Station Facilities and Access

Castle Bar Park Station, though modest in its offerings, ensures basic services to its travelers. The station does have a ticket office, operational Monday to Friday from 07:00 to 10:00. However, don't count on finding ticket machines, as they are not available at this station, nor is there an option for collecting tickets purchased online.

If you require assistance or information, there is a help point available. However, note that staff help isn't available, so you might want to plan ahead for any support needed. CCTV cameras are operational across the station, enhancing security for all passengers.

Accessibility might pose some challenges here, as the station provides step-free access only to platform 1. Beyond this, the narrow platform design prevents ramp-assisted access, and those needing it are advised to contact GWR's Passenger Assistance team. Wheelchairs are not available, and there are no elevators or ramps for other platforms.
